Explanation: “GROUP BY” is used with aggregate functions. … Explanation: “GROUP BY” clause s used for aggregation of field. 9.
What is the meaning of GROUP BY clause in my SQL?
The MYSQL GROUP BY Clause is used to collect data from multiple records and group the result by one or more column. It is generally used in a SELECT statement. You can also use some aggregate functions like COUNT, SUM, MIN, MAX, AVG etc.
What is the meaning of GROUP BY clause?
The GROUP BY clause is a SQL command that is used to group rows that have the same values. The GROUP BY clause is used in the SELECT statement. Optionally it is used in conjunction with aggregate functions to produce summary reports from the database. That’s what it does, summarizing data from the database.
What is the meaning of order by clause in SQL Mcq?
This set of MySQL Multiple Choice Questions & Answers (MCQs) focuses on “The order by Clauses – 1”. … Explanation: “ORDER BY” clause is used for sorting while “GROUP BY” clause is used for aggregation of fields.
Which among the following not belongs to an aggregate function?
Which of the following is not a built in aggregate function in SQL? Explanation: SQL does not include total as a built in aggregate function. The avg is used to find average, max is used to find the maximum and the count is used to count the number of values.
What is the meaning of group by?
The GROUP BY statement groups rows that have the same values into summary rows, like “find the number of customers in each country”. The GROUP BY statement is often used with aggregate functions ( COUNT() , MAX() , MIN() , SUM() , AVG() ) to group the result-set by one or more columns.
What is group by 1 in MySQL?
It means to group by the first column regardless of what it’s called. You can do the same with ORDER BY .
What is GROUP BY and ORDER BY in SQL?
1. Group by statement is used to group the rows that have the same value. Whereas Order by statement sort the result-set either in ascending or in descending order. … In select statement, it is always used before the order by keyword. While in select statement, it is always used after the group by keyword.
What is ORDER BY clause in SQL?
An ORDER BY clause in SQL specifies that a SQL SELECT statement returns a result set with the rows being sorted by the values of one or more columns. … ORDER BY is the only way to sort the rows in the result set. Without this clause, the relational database system may return the rows in any order.
How are ORDER BY and GROUP BY having clauses different in SQL?
ORDER BY clauses. Use the ORDER BY clause to display the output table of a query in either ascending or descending alphabetical order. Whereas the GROUP BY clause gathers rows into groups and sorts the groups into alphabetical order, ORDER BY sorts individual rows.
What of the following the having clause does?
The HAVING clause does which of the following? Acts like a WHERE clause but is used for groups rather than rows. … Acts like a WHERE clause but is used for columns rather than groups.
What is the default order followed by Order By clause Mcq?
SQL Order By clause syntax. We can see the syntax for SQL Order by clause as follows. In SQL ORDER BY clause, we need to define ascending or descending order in which result needs to be sorted. By default, SQL Server sorts out results using ORDER BY clause in ascending order.
What is true for GROUP BY order by clause?
Answer: A. Processing order starts from FROM clause to get the table names, then restricting rows using WHERE clause, grouping them using GROUP BY clause, restricting groups using HAVING clause. ORDER BY clause is the last one to be processed to sort the final data set.
Can SELECT clause be used without the clause from?
Can “SELECT” clause be used without the clause “FROM”? Explanation: “SELECT” clause is used to show rows and columns of a particular table and clause “from” is used to denote a table name. … Explanation: “SELECT” clause cannot be used without clause “FROM”.
What is the difference between WHERE and HAVING clause Mcq?
WHERE Clause is used to filter the records from the table based on the specified condition. HAVING Clause is used to filter record from the groups based on the specified condition.